The Arizona Cardinals have tendered exclusive rights free agent Greg Dortch, which will cost them $1.12 million on their salary cap. This was a move that most expected to happen and is now official. After a breakout second half of the season last year during quarterback Kyler Murray’s return, Greg Dortch will remain Murray’s target in the slot.
The Arizona Cardinals Begin Filling Out Their Receiver Room
Tendering Greg Dortch is first move for a wide receiver unit expecting some change in an effort to give Kyler Murray more offensive fire power this upcoming season. Many believe the Cardinals will spend one of their two first round draft picks (4th and 27th) on a top wide receiver prospect, with Ohio State star Marvin Harrison Jr as the name mentioned most. The Cardinals will also have a decision to make as Kyler Murray’s close friend and top target from a season ago Marquise “Hollywood” Brown is scheduled to his free agency next week.
Dortch’s Breakout Play
Greg Dortch began turning heads when he burst onto the scene as an undrafted rookie in 2022. Dortch quickly built a reputation as a player who may not get a ton of snaps, but when given the opportunity will make an impact on the field in a variety of ways. That continued in 2023 when Kyler Murray reentered the lineup for the Cardinals final 8 games of the season. During that time, Greg Dortch recorded 23 catches for 278 yards and 2 touchdowns, while also serving as a returner, returning 29 punts and 17 kicks for a total of 635 yards. Dortch has been a player with strong work ethic that leaves it all out on the field when he is given the opportunity.
Arizona Cardinals fans have been clamoring for Greg Dortch to get more playing time. Fortunately for them number 83 will be back in the red and white next season.
